God Is Spirit
 God is Spirit (John 4:21-24)
 Is not like any created thing
(Exodus 20:4-6)
 Does not have a specific location (Ps 139:7-10)
 Does not have a physical body and is not made of matter
 We also have spirits: John 4:24, 1 Cor 14:14, Phil. 3:3,
1 Corinthians 6:17, Rom. 8:16, Lk. 23:46; Eccl 12:7,
Heb 12:23; Philippians 1:23-24
 God’s spirituality means that God exists as a being that
is not made of any matter, has no parts or dimensions,
is unable to be perceived by our bodily senses, and is
more excellent that any other kind of existence.
Invisibility
 God’s invisibility means that God’s total essence, all of
His spiritual being, will never be able to be seen by us,
yet God still shows Himself to us through visible, created
things.
 God cannot be seen: John 1:18, 6:46, 1 Tim. 1:17, 6:16;
1 John 4:12
 Some outward manifestations of God can be seen:
Exodus 33:11,20, 21-23
 Theophanies – God manifestations in the OT Gen 18;1-
33, 32:28-30; Exodus13:21-22, 24:9-11; Judges 13:21-
22, Isaiah 6:1
 Seen in Christ: John 14:9, Colossians 1;15 Hebrews 1:3
 We shall see God in Heaven: Matthew 5:8, Revelation
1:7,
Knowledge
 God fully knows Himself and all things actual and possible in
one simple and eternal act.
 God knows everything: Job 37:16, 1 John 3:20
 Only God fully knows God: 1 Cor. 2:10-11
 God is light and has perfect awareness – 1 Jn 1:5
 God knows all things actual: Heb. 4:13, 2 Chron 16:9, Job
28:24, Matt. 10:29-30
 God knows the future: Isa. 46:9-10, 42:8-9, Matt 6:8, 10:30
 God knows in detail: Ps. 139:1-4, 16
 God knows what is possible: 1 Samuel 23:11-13, Matthew
11:21-23; 2 Kings 13:19,
 Has perfect knowledge: Ps 139:6, 90:4, Is. 55:9; 2 Peter 3:8
Knowledge & Free Will
 God knows everything but He has given human beings
reasonable self-determination.
 We have some degree of real decision-making power
with real causes and effects.
 But our free will is “bounded” (I cannot change the laws
of gravity).
 God ability to set the boundaries, times and conditions
and to intervene supernaturally means that the overall
course of history is pre-determined.
 God also knows our natures and what the possible
outcomes of our choices will be.
 We can make all the moves we like but God will always
win the game of chess!
Wisdom
 God’s wisdom means that God always chooses the
best goals and the best means to those goals
 Biblical wisdom is always concerned with practical
outcomes rather than philosophical abstraction
 God is Wise: Romans 16:27; Job 9:4, 12;13, Ps.
104:24
 In Redemption: 1 Cor. 1;18-30, Romans 11;33, Eph
3:6-10
 In His Plans: Rom 8:28-30, 2 Cor. 12:8-10
 Received By Faith: James 1:5-8, Ps. 19:7
 Depends of Fearing God: Ps. 111;10, Prov. 1:7, 9:10
Truthfulness & Faithfulness
 God’s truthfulness means that He is the true God,
and that all His knowledge and words are both true
and the final standard of truth.
 God creates Reality and acts in line with that which
is real and true, substantial, abiding and permanent.
 True God: Jeremiah 10:10-11 John 17:3, 1 John
5:20
 Faithful and True: Deut 32:4, Num 23:19, 2 Sam
7:28,
Ps. 141:6, Revelation 3:14, 19:11, 21:5, 22:6
 Is not false and does not lie: Titus 1:2, Heb 6:18, Ps.
12:6, Prov. 30:5
 Word is Truth: John 17:17
 We are to be truthful: Eph. 4:25, Ex. 20:16, Ps 15;2,
Goodness
 The goodness of God means that God is the final
standard of good, and all that God is and does is
worthy of approval.
 God is good: Luke 18:19, Ps. 100:5, 106:1, 107:1,
34:8
 Good = worthy of approval, useful, fitting, works
perfectly, brings about desirable outcomes
 The source of all good: James 1:17, Ps. 145:9, Acts
14:17, Matthew 7:11,
 We should respond in thankfulness: Ps. 106:1,
107:1
1 Thess. 5:18
Love
 God’s love means that God eternally gives of Himself
to others
 Love – practical benevolence, appreciation, etc.
 Wanting the very best for another / self-sacrifice
 God is love: 1 John 4:8
 Within the Trinity: John 3:35, 17:24, 14;31
 Toward us: Romans 5:8, John 3:16, 1 John 4:10,
Gal. 2:20
 We are to love God and love others: Matthew 22:37-
38, 1 John 3:16-18, 1 Corinthians 13
 Love involves obeying God’s commandments: 1 Jn
5:3
Mercy, Grace, Patience
 Exodus 34:6,7
 Mercy – a) lifting of punishment b) doing good
 Grace – unmerited favor, God’s riches at Christ’s
expense
 Patience – God giving us time to learn, repent, and
grow.
 Mercy: 2 Corinthians 1:3, 2 Samuel 24:14, Matthew
5:7
 God will treat us as we treat others so we should
also be merciful, gracious and patient.
 Grace: 1 Peter 5:10, 1 Cor. 15:10, Romans 4:16,
 Patient / Slow to Anger: Ex. 34:6, James 1:19,
Holiness
 Separated from sin, untainted, undefiled,
consecrated
 Perfect in every moral quality
 Beautiful, precious, to be honored above all things
 God is holy: Isaiah 6:3, Psalms: 71;22, 78:41, 89:18
 We should be holy: Lev. 19:2, 1 Peter 1:16, Ex.
19:4-6
 Holiness is essential to eternity: Heb. 12:10,14
 We are to be separated to God: 2 Cor. 6:14-18
 We are to work at being holy: 2 Cor 7:1, Rom 12:1
Peace / Order
 Shalom – a divine order that causes stability and
blessedness and which results in the ability to be
fruitful, multiply, to have dominion and to dwell in
love.
 God of peace: Romans 15:33, 16:20, Philippians 4:9
 Opposed to chaos, conflict and disorder: Genesis
chapter1, Isaiah 54:11-12, 1 Corinthians 14:33
 A fruit of the Spirit: Galatians 5:22-23 Romans 14:17
 The result of wisdom in life: Proverbs 3:17
Righteousness / Justice
 From the Hebrew words for “straight”
 The opposite of crooked, perverse or oppressive
 Just and right is He (Deut 32:4, Genesis 18:25)
 Rewards good and punishes iniquity
 The appropriate response for every action /
circumstance
 God’s justice includes mercy for those who repent
and place faith in Jesus Christ (Rom 3:25-16, 1 Jn
1:9)
Jealousy / Zeal
 God values and protects His relationship with us
 God is angry when we love idols or the world – these
are regarded as spiritual adultery
 God is strongly invested in His people and His honor
 Opposite of uncaring, apathetic, uninterested in
relationship, distant or aloof.
 Exodus 20:5, 34:14, Deut. 4:24, 5:9, Isaiah 48:11
 1 Corinthians 10: 20-22, James 4:4
Wrath
 God’s wrath means that He intensely hates all sin.
 Exodus 32:9,10; Deut. 9:7-8, 29;23 2 Kings 22:13
 Both an emotion and an outward action
 Is constrained by God’s patience, forbearance and mercy
 Ps 103:8-9, Romans 2:4, 2 Peter 3:9,10
 It is revealed against ungodliness and wickedness;
Romans 1:18, 2:5-8, 5:9, 9:22, Colossians 3:6, 1 Thess
1;10
 Christians do not know the wrath of God: Eph 2:4-7, John
5:24,25; 1 Thess. 1;10, Romans 5;10
 But we do know the discipline of God: Hebrews 12:5-14
 Culminates in the End Time plagues : Revelation chapter
16
Will, Freedom and Omnipotence
 God wills everything into being for His freely
determined purposes and has the power to bring all
these purposes to pass.
 Ephesians 1:1-14, 3:9, 4:10
 Colossians 1:16-17, Romans 11:36, 1 Cor 8:6, 15:27-
28
 Not the despotic will of “fate” but a loving and righteous
and gracious will that respects His covenant
relationships
 God’s will by decree / Providence “as the Lord wills”
 God’s will revealed by and included in covenant
 God’s moral will as communicated for us to perform
Three Illustrations
 Bar of Silver: electrons roam freely, voltage is
determined
 Two Trains: destination is pre-determined (Heaven or
Hell) but you can choose which train to ride. All who
are in Christ are predestined to Heaven (that’s where
Christ takes you) , all who follow the Anti-Christ are
predestined to Hell (that is where he is going).
 Degrees of Determination: a few individuals are
specially chosen for certain destinies (Pharaoh,
Moses, Samson, Cyrus, Judas, John the Baptist, Paul)
but even then they can compromise their destiny
(Moses, Samson) or fulfill it (Paul, John the Baptist),
we are not robots but God can set our general life
paths even from before birth.
Perfection, Blessedness, Beauty
 God is perfect in all aspects, is totally fulfilled and
blessed and is the sum of all beauty and desirability
and joy.
 God’s perfection means that he can in now ay be
tainted or compromised by evil.
 God’s perfection means that His love is complete:
Matthew 5:48, Ps. 18:30, Deut. 32:4
 God is blessed: 1 Timothy 1:11, 6:15
 God is beautiful: Ps. 27:4 and desirable Ps. 73:25
Glory
 Hebrew: kabod – heavy, weighty, dignified,
honorable, of excellent reputation, worthy.
Ps. 24:7-10, 29:1-11, 104:1,2
 Jesus as God’s glory: Hebrews 1:3, Matthew 17;2,
 The brightness that surrounds God’s revelation of
Himself
Ex. 24:15-18, Ezekiel 1:28, Luke 2:9, Revelation
21:23
 The glory of God is closely related to the nature of
God
 Exodus 34:1-7
 We are glorified as we share God’s image 2 Cor.
3:17,18
